🥘 Ingredients

10 items
  • 4 pieces Bo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 2 cups Crispy fried onions
  • 0.5 cups All-purpose flour
  • 2 pieces Eggs
  • 2 tablespoons Milk
  • 1 teaspoons Salt
  • 0.5 teaspoons Black pepper
  • 1 teaspoons Garlic powder
  • 0.5 teaspoons Paprika
  • 1 as needed Cooking spray or oil

📝 Instructions

13 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per or lightly grease it with cooking spray.

2

Place the crispy fried onions in a resealable plastic bag. Crush them with a rolling pin or your hands until they resemble coarse crumbs, then transfer them to a shallow dish.

3

In another shallow dish, mix the flour, salt, black pepper, garlic powder, and paprika.

4

In a third shallow dish, whisk together the eggs and milk until well combined.

5

Pound the chicken breasts to an even thickness, about 1 inch thick, to ensure even cooking.

6

Dredge each chicken breast in the flour mixture, shaking off any excess.

7

Dip the floured chicken breasts into the egg mixture, allowing any excess to drip off.

8

Press the chicken breasts into the crushed fried onions, making sure they are evenly coated on all sides.

9

Place the coated chicken breasts onto the prepared baking sheet, leaving a little space between each piece.

10

Lightly spray the tops of the chicken breasts with cooking spray or drizzle with a small amount of oil to enhance crispiness.

11

Bake in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es, or until the ch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C) and the crust is golden brown and crispy.

12

Remove the chicken breasts from the oven and let rest for 5 minutes before serving.

13

Serve warm with your favorite sides such as mashed potatoes, steamed vegetables, or a fresh salad.
